Output e7cd69e33e320ac31fb742b9ff1d49fe23dabb90fb0cf3efdb6f0e0b82d41b2c:0

value
163898
script pubkey
OP_0 OP_PUSHBYTES_20 8b696634447bb676e8c3a29bd76445c7848f8abc
address
bc1q3d5kvdzy0wm8d6xr52dawez9c7zglz4uwsqa7h
transaction
e7cd69e33e320ac31fb742b9ff1d49fe23dabb90fb0cf3efdb6f0e0b82d41b2c
confirmations
142979
spent
true